Danny and his younger brother, Jeff, are comparing their trophy collections. Danny has 3 soccer trophies and 6 basketball trophies. Jeff has 2 soccer trophies and 4 basketball trophies. Do Danny and Jeff have the same ratio of soccer trophies to basketball trophies?

Answers

Answer:

Yes

Step-by-step explanation:

The ratio for Danny would be 3 / 6 which simplifies to 1 / 2

For Jeff the ratio would be 2 / 4 which simplifies to 1 / 2 as well

People who traveled between Philadelphia and New York City by different vehicles (train, car, bus, or plane) were surveyed to see how pleasant the experience has been. Pleasantness was measured on an interval scale. What statistical test should be used to analyze these data to see if different modes of travel were associated with different mean levels of pleasantness

Answers

To analyze the data and determine if different modes of travel are associated with different mean levels of pleasantness, a suitable statistical test to consider would be the Analysis of Variance (ANOVA). ANOVA is commonly used when comparing means between multiple groups or categories.

In this case, the independent variable is the mode of travel (train, car, bus, or plane), which has multiple categories. The dependent variable is the level of pleasantness, measured on an interval scale.

By conducting an ANOVA, you can assess whether there are significant differences in mean levels of pleasantness across the different modes of travel. The test will determine if there is evidence to suggest that the means of the groups are not all equal, indicating a potential association between travel mode and pleasantness.

If the ANOVA test indicates that there are significant differences, you can perform posthoc tests, such as Tukey's Honestly Significant Difference (HSD) test or Bonferroni correction, to identify which specific modes of travel have significantly different mean levels of pleasantness.

It's important to note that the appropriateness of the ANOVA assumes that the data meets the necessary assumptions, such as normality and homogeneity of variances. These assumptions should be checked before conducting the analysis.

Which expression is equivalent to this polynomial?

9x^2 + 4


A. (3x + 2i)(3x − 2i)

B. (3x + 2)(3x − 2)

C. (3x + 2i)^2

D. (3x + 2)^2


Answer: A. (3x + 2i)(3x − 2i)


I hope this helps.

Answers

Answer:

A is the answer.

Step-by-step explanation:

In the first, we must know i^2 is (-1)

so we can get the answer is A.

A.(3x + 2i)(3x − 2i)

= (3x)^2 - (2i)^2

= 9x^2 + 4 (Answer)

B. (3x + 2)(3x − 2) = 9x^2 - 4

C. (3x + 2i)^2

= 9x^2 + 12ix - 4

D. (3x + 2)^2

= 9x^2 + 12x + 4
